Everyone should use this data when working on the Soos Creek velocities. Do not erase any original data you have! All scientists keep all original data in case there is a question at some point about how we got our final numbers - or they do after the first time they toss something, figuring the processed numbers are all they need, and then can't find something important from those original notes. Just last week I had to go back to data logs from May 2002 to figure out where I had taken wavelength-dispersive spectrometer measurements during an electron microprobe session. Boy, was I glad I hadn't erased anything... So you can either copy this data into extra space in your lab, or just print it out and use it.
